Black Woman Admitted to NYC Hospital Over 100 Days Ago, But Nobody Knows Who She Is

Nationwide — Mount Sinai Morningside Hospital in New York Metropolis is asking for the general public’s assist in figuring out a girl of African descent who has remained hospitalized for greater than 100 days with out anybody coming ahead to assert her. The unidentified girl was admitted on April 12 after being discovered sitting alone on a bus cease bench at one hundred and twenty fifth Road and Lenox Avenue in Harlem. A involved bystander referred to as 911, prompting emergency companies to take her to the hospital.

In line with a information launch obtained by Folks, the lady is believed to frequent the realm the place she was discovered and will go by the title “Pam.” Hospital workers say she usually attire in black and infrequently hides her face, making it troublesome for folks to acknowledge or interact together with her. Regardless of being on the hospital for over three months, no household, pals, or acquaintances have come ahead to substantiate her id.

Mount Sinai describes the lady as a Black feminine, presumably in her 50s, standing about 5 ft 8 inches tall and weighing round 170 kilos. She has darkish brown eyes and black hair with grey streaks. Whereas the hospital didn’t launch particular particulars about her situation, they confirmed that she has remained underneath medical care since her arrival.

Employees at Mount Sinai are persevering with to look after her whereas exploring each attainable lead. They’re hoping that members of the Harlem neighborhood—or anybody who could have seen her within the space—would possibly acknowledge her and assist determine her. Flyers and digital outreach efforts are being utilized in hopes of triggering a reminiscence or connection that would assist clear up the thriller.

The scenario has drawn concern from each hospital workers and the broader neighborhood, who’re puzzled by how somebody might go unrecognized for therefore lengthy. “We simply wish to give her again her id,” one hospital employee mentioned, noting that each particular person deserves to be seen and supported. Authorities are additionally concerned within the case, working alongside the hospital to search out solutions.

Anybody with details about the lady’s id is inspired to contact the hospital instantly at 646-901-9309. The hospital emphasised the significance of neighborhood involvement in serving to reconnect the affected person together with her household, if she has one, and to make sure she will get the continued help she wants.
